Annotation:

The Presidium and delegates of the congress in the hall of the Kremlin Palace of Congresses. The eighth day of the congress. The delegates discuss the report of the Chairman of the Council of Ministers of the USSR N. I. Ryzhkov "On the Main Directions of Economic and Social Development of the USSR for 1986-1990 and for the Period up to 2000" (synchronously). President of the USSR Academy of Sciences G. I. Marchuk, Chairman of the Communist Party of the USA G. Hall, Chairman of the Central Committee of the Communist Party of Uruguay R. Arizmendi answer journalists' questions during a press conference. Foreign guests visit the Moscow Ordzhonikidze Machine-Tool Plant, the Mikromashina Plant, and the All-Union Art Exhibition "We Are Building Communism".
